Jeju Town, the northern A part of the island, has a tendency to be colder in Winter season than the southern aspect as a result of affect of continental seasonal winds. Gosan-ri, Situated around the west aspect from the island, has the bottom once-a-year typical precipitation around the island, but as opposed to most elements of mainland Korea, the seasonal precipitation is even.

Jusangjeolli Cliff is often a spectacular 20m large black basalt cliff website shaped due to lava flows from Mt Hallasan. The lava flows cooled into adjoining hexagonal formed stone pillars, that have been eroded over time to type the wonderful cliffs.

Samyang Black Sand Beach front is exclusive in having black sand, when compared Together with the white sand on most other Jeju Island beaches. Samyang Black Sand Seaside is a well-liked locale for swimming, surfing, sailing, and sand bathing. it really is fewer popular to travelers so is commonly a a lot less website chaotic Beach front to visit.
